### **How do I close my Titan account?**

To close your Titan account, login here and click into your investment account > select **Settings** > select **Close Account**. This action will initiate a full liquidation of any remaining funds and ensure your account is closed thereafter.  
  
Alternatively, you can send a message to the Wealth Team via chat or via email to [support@titan.com](mailto:support@titan.com). If you are requesting a liquidation to your linked bank, please confirm which bank account you would like the funds to be sent to.

From there, our team will submit the request on your behalf, or will walk you through next steps pending on how you would like to transfer the funds. Your account closure will not be complete until all funds have been sent back to your bank account.

###   
**Why did I receive a withdrawal cancellation email after submitting a request to close my account?**  
  

If you had a pending withdrawal request and then submitted a closure request, the original withdrawal is automatically canceled. A new request is created to fully liquidate your account, which may trigger an email notifying you of the canceled withdrawal.

###   
**How long does it take to receive funds after closing my account?**  
  

*   **Standard accounts:** Liquidation begins within 1–2 business days, and funds usually arrive in your linked bank account within 2–4 business days.  
      
    
*   **Transfers over $100,000:** Our custodian processes these in smaller batches of $100,000 or less per business day. You’ll receive multiple deposits over each business day until the full amount is delivered.  
      
    
*   **Interval funds:** Timelines differ. See Interval Funds below.

**Fees**  
  

### **Are there fees to close my Titan account?**  
  

Our custodian, Apex Clearing, may charge an account closure fee depending on account type:

*   **Individual brokerage accounts:** No fee  
      
    
*   **IRA accounts:** $100 closure fee (waived if the account was never funded)  
      
    

* * *

###   
**Are there fees to transfer my account to another firm?**  
  

Yes. Apex charges a **$100 transfer fee per transfer**. If you’re transferring an IRA, the $100 closure fee also applies.

**Examples:**

*   Individual account transfer → $100  
      
    
*   IRA transfer → $100 transfer fee + $100 closure fee = $200  
      
    
*   Both together → $300
    

Transfers are initiated by the receiving firm. You can find full instructions [here](https://help.titan.com/en_us/how-to-transfer-a-titan-account-to-another-firm-HkasRkPr9).

**Interval Funds**  
  

### **What should I know about closing an account with Interval Fund Holdings?**  
  

*   Liquidations occur only during quarterly redemption windows (four times per year). You can view dates in the app on the fund’s page.
    
*   Proceeds typically reach your bank account within ~3 weeks of the redemption date.
    
*   If liquidity is limited, you may receive a partial payout. Your account remains open until all funds are fully redeemed.
    
*   Advisory and fund-level fees continue to apply while any balance remains invested.
    

* * *

###   
**How do interval funds work?**  
  

*   Redemptions are processed quarterly, regardless of when requests are made.
    
*   If demand is high, payouts are distributed pro-rata, meaning you may receive less than requested.
    
*   Because of their illiquid nature, interval funds are generally best suited for long-term investors. Please review the fund’s prospectus for details.
